   For those who are thinking about starting their own business in the form of an e-commerce store, or selling products on Ebay, most will seek out products for resale that have the best turnover and profit potential. Consumer electronics, designer clothing, to name a few, are among the top product picks, and are generally perceived as the path toward a successful enterprise.

However, most corporate brand owners will require that you own a brick and mortar retail store, and insist on purchasing minimums that can be as high as 100,000 dollars per year. Most will not let you sell their product online, and never from an auction format such as Ebay.

Without the required capital and storefront, legitimate brand name merchandise marketing can present an insurmountable financial barrier to entry. Find out why an overlooked industry like the wholesale novelty business can cost you very little to start, and bring you more profit per item then most products that enjoy popular retail status.

A fascinating eBay case study is the number one seller on eBay, a little outfit called Marie's CDs, but is better known under its old name 1 Cent CD. Jay and Marie, current ID jayandmarie, are an institution on eBay and are a big part of what makes eBay such an amazingly popular phenomenon. This little company is literally an eBay dream come true. They started small out of their home in California in 1999 and began growing quickly. To date they have completed over 1 million auctions on eBay and have a feedback rating of 177,018 with 99% satisfaction from their customers!

The ability to locate reasonably priced merchandise to sell can make or break a business. Here are seven places to start looking. The mantra of every successful entrepreneur who sells products is the same--buy low and sell high. Your ability to buy cheap is of paramount importance; after all, it makes up 50 percent of the success equation.

If you plan to buy and sell new products, your buying sources will include manufacturers, sales agents, craftspeople, wholesalers, importers, distributors and liquidators. Deciding whom you will buy from will be largely based on criteria relative to your specific needs, and revolve around product price, supplier reliability, product quality, product and supplier guarantee, supplier terms, and supplier fulfillment.
